PSHE/RSE parent pack

Personal, Social, Health and Economics education (PSHE) and Relationships and Sex Education (RSE) and health have been part of our well-balanced and broad curriculum for a long time.

 

Following government changes to the content that must be statutorily taught, we are reviewing our provision and are required to update our policies. As part of this, we are also required to consult with parents to take account of your views and needs in order to provide the best possible curriculum for our children.

 

A clear and staged process is being followed, which includes consultation sessions. The attached resources - in this ‘parent pack’ - are intended to provide helpful background and supporting information for you as parents.
